Invited for the front cover of this issue are Stefanie Tschierlei, Sven Rau and co‐workers. The image shows the fusion of an organic chromophore with a Ru II polypyridine moiety resulting in a unique bichromophoric photosensitizer. Read the full text of the article at 10.1002/chem.202103609.
